What to look for in bullbars for the Ford Ranger

If you're comparing two products, here's the comparison framework that separates the winners from the regrets:

  • Compatibility with other mods — Does the Bullbars part play nicely with bullbars, suspension, sensors, and ABS? On the Ford Ranger, this matters more than on simpler platforms.
  • Generation-specific fitment — Don't trust generic 'Ford Ranger' listings. Year ranges and chassis codes matter. A part listed for one generation will rarely cross-fit cleanly to another.
  • LVVTA / WoF signalling — Reputable suppliers state cert requirements explicitly. If a supplier hedges or hand-waves, that's a signal worth paying attention to.
  • Material and coating quality — In NZ, the difference between marine-grade powder coat and zinc plating is two years of life or ten. Anywhere coastal — Northland, East Cape, the West Coast — needs the upgrade.
  • Documentation — Installation specs, torque values, and re-check intervals should come with the part. If they don't, you're buying half a product.

Installation notes

  • Document the install — Take photos, save invoices, save spec sheets. If the ute ever gets sold or needs a re-cert, this paperwork is gold.
  • Don't substitute fasteners — Use the supplied bolts, washers, and nuts. Hardware-store substitutions are how good kits become bad ones.
  • Wheel alignment after any geometry change — Even minor Bullbars changes can affect tracking. An alignment is far cheaper than a set of front tyres eaten in 5,000 km.
  • Use anti-seize or marine-grade thread compound — Especially in coastal NZ. Future-you will thank present-you when bolts come out cleanly five years later.
  • Threadlocker on the right fasteners — Medium-strength on anything that vibrates and isn't routinely serviced. Skip the high-strength stuff unless the spec sheet calls for it — you'll wreck threads getting it apart later.

Long-term maintenance

  1. Every 10,000 km — torque check on all serviceable Bullbars fasteners. Use a torque wrench, not a feel-test. Document any bolt that needed re-tensioning.
  2. Every 20,000 km — wear part assessment. Bushes, mounts, and consumables all have a real-world lifespan in NZ conditions. Replace as a set, not one-by-one.
  3. Every 5,000 km — visual inspection. Walk around the ute. Look for fluid weep, cracked bushes, sagging components, missing bolts. Ten minutes saves thousands.
  4. Annually — full system review with measured ride heights, alignment, and a written record. A 10mm sag on one side over twelve months is a sign that a component is failing.
